Abstract
本实用新型公开了一种市政用具有防腐蚀作用的排水管道,包括水泥排水管,水泥排水管的外壁上设有一层具有防水抗腐蚀的聚乙烯膜,水泥排水管的内壁及其端面上涂有一层具有防水防腐蚀作用的聚四氟乙烯层。本实用新型的有益效果:在水泥排水管的外壁上设有具有防水抗腐蚀的聚乙烯膜,避免了腐蚀性土壤对排水管道外壁的腐蚀伤害,也达到防水效果。在排水管道内壁及其端面上涂有具有防水防腐蚀作用的聚四氟乙烯层,避免了所排放液体对排水管道内部产生腐蚀伤害,且使管道内部更加光滑,以及支管之间更易连接不易受到腐蚀。
The utility model discloses a municipal drainage pipe with anti-corrosion function, which comprises a cement drainage pipe, a layer of waterproof and anti-corrosion polyethylene film is arranged on the outer wall of the cement drainage pipe, and the inner wall and the end surface of the cement drainage pipe are coated with There is a polytetrafluoroethylene layer with waterproof and anti-corrosion effect. The utility model has beneficial effects: the outer wall of the cement drainage pipe is provided with a waterproof and anti-corrosion polyethylene film, which avoids corrosion damage to the outer wall of the drainage pipe by corrosive soil and achieves waterproof effect. The inner wall of the drainage pipe and its end surface are coated with a waterproof and anti-corrosion polytetrafluoroethylene layer, which prevents the discharged liquid from causing corrosion damage to the interior of the drainage pipe, and makes the inside of the pipe smoother, and the branch pipes are easier to connect and less susceptible to damage. corrosion.
Description
技术领域 technical field
本实用新型涉及一种市政用具有防腐蚀作用的排水管道。 The utility model relates to a municipal drainage pipe with anti-corrosion effect.
背景技术 Background technique
市政排水管道系统是城市的基础设施之一,其与供电、供暖、供水、以及通信线路等都是城市建设的重要环节。随着我国城市化进程的不断加快,导致城市内的人口急剧增加,南水北调,西气东输已经成为普遍现象,且伴随着工业的发展,各类工业废水、城市污水的合理处理刻不容缓,因此管道项目也越来越受重视。 The municipal drainage pipeline system is one of the infrastructures of the city, and it is an important part of urban construction along with power supply, heating, water supply, and communication lines. With the continuous acceleration of the urbanization process in our country, the population in the city has increased sharply, the south-to-north water diversion, and the west-to-east gas transmission have become common phenomena. Projects are also getting more and more attention.
现有的市政用排水管道由水泥排水管,连接件组成,雨水,各类混合的城市污水,甚至有些不合规格排放的工业废水,以及围绕管道的具有酸性的土壤,均会对排水管道产生腐蚀作用,若不及时处理,最终甚至会污染周围土壤,对城市建设和管理非常不利。 The existing municipal drainage pipes are composed of cement drainage pipes and connectors. Rainwater, various mixed urban sewage, and even some substandard industrial wastewater, as well as the acidic soil surrounding the pipes, will corrode the drainage pipes. If it is not treated in time, it will eventually even pollute the surrounding soil, which is very unfavorable to urban construction and management.
CN104373749A公开了一种预制直埋防腐管道,工作管的管道外壁上粘贴安装有2根扁平的,具有凹槽的可镶嵌报警线的报警电缆带,其中,报警线和工作管表面均涂刷有防腐材料层或缠绕聚乙烯板带。因此可提前发现管道泄漏问题,并提前介入管道维修。 CN104373749A discloses a prefabricated directly buried anti-corrosion pipeline. Two flat alarm cable belts with grooves that can be inlaid with alarm lines are pasted on the outer wall of the working tube. Anti-corrosion material layer or wrapping polyethylene sheet tape. Therefore, pipeline leakage problems can be detected in advance, and pipeline repairs can be intervened in advance.
但现有技术不能同时提供排水管道内外侧的防腐功能;排水管道之间的连接处易出现泄漏状况,若不能及时检测出,将导致巨大损失;排水管道在已被挖动过的土壤中不易水平固定,会导致排水管道之间不易连接。 However, the existing technology cannot provide the anti-corrosion function of the inside and outside of the drainage pipe at the same time; the joints between the drainage pipes are prone to leaks, and if they cannot be detected in time, it will cause huge losses; the drainage pipes are not easy in the excavated soil. Fixed horizontally, it will make it difficult to connect the drainage pipes.
实用新型内容 Utility model content
针对现有技术存在的不足,本实用新型的目的在于提供一种市政用具有防腐蚀作用的排水管道。 Aiming at the deficiencies in the prior art, the purpose of the utility model is to provide a municipal drainage pipe with anti-corrosion effect.
为实现上述目的,本实用新型提供了如下技术方案: In order to achieve the above object, the utility model provides the following technical solutions:
一种市政用的排水管道,包括水泥排水管,所述的水泥排水管的外壁上设有具有防水抗腐蚀的聚乙烯膜,所述的水泥排水管的内壁及其端面上涂有具有防水防腐蚀作用的聚四氟乙烯层。 A municipal drainage pipe, comprising a cement drainage pipe, the outer wall of the cement drainage pipe is provided with a waterproof and anti-corrosion polyethylene film, and the inner wall of the cement drainage pipe and its end surface are coated with a waterproof and anti-corrosion film. Corrosive action of the PTFE layer.
本实用新型的优点是:在水泥排水管的外壁上设有具有防水抗腐蚀的聚乙烯膜,避免了腐蚀性土壤对排水管道外壁的腐蚀伤害,也达到防水效果。在排水管道内壁及其端面上涂有具有防水防腐蚀作用的聚四氟乙烯层,避免了所排放液体对排水管道内部产生腐蚀伤害,且使管道内部更加光滑,以及支管之间更易连接不易受到腐蚀。 The utility model has the advantages that: the outer wall of the cement drainage pipe is provided with a waterproof and anti-corrosion polyethylene film, which avoids the corrosion damage of the corrosive soil to the outer wall of the drainage pipe and achieves the waterproof effect. The inner wall of the drainage pipe and its end surface are coated with a waterproof and anti-corrosion polytetrafluoroethylene layer, which prevents the discharged liquid from causing corrosion damage to the interior of the drainage pipe, and makes the inside of the pipe smoother, and the branch pipes are easier to connect and less susceptible to damage. corrosion.
本实用新型进一步设置为:水泥排水管具有若干个,在水泥排水管端面之间缠绕止水带,止水带附近设置有漏液检测系统,所述的漏液检测系统由压力感应器、发射器、接收器以及示警器组成,将压力感应器用防水薄膜包覆,所述的止水带和漏液检测系统之间具有一定空间并且同置于连接套中。 The utility model is further set as follows: there are several cement drainage pipes, waterstops are wound between the end faces of the cement drainage pipes, a liquid leakage detection system is arranged near the waterstops, and the leakage detection system is composed of a pressure sensor, an emission The pressure sensor is covered with a waterproof film, and there is a certain space between the waterstop and the leakage detection system and they are placed in the connecting sleeve.
本实用新型的优点是:一旦连接处出现漏液现象,止水带会立刻膨胀,起到阻止液体泄漏的效果,同时,止水带会填满连接套,压迫压力感应器,导致其发生感应,经发射器和接收器传递给示警器,可及时准确检测出哪一处管道连接处发生漏液现象,立刻进行抢修,减少损失和污染。 The utility model has the advantages that once liquid leakage occurs at the joint, the water stop will expand immediately to prevent liquid leakage. , which is transmitted to the warning device by the transmitter and receiver, which can detect the leakage of the pipeline connection in time and accurately, and immediately carry out emergency repairs to reduce losses and pollution.
本实用新型进一步设置为:在水泥排水管的底端设有梯形加固台,所述梯形加固台具有与水泥排水管的底端抵接的曲面部。 The utility model is further configured as follows: a trapezoidal reinforcement platform is provided at the bottom end of the cement drainage pipe, and the trapezoidal reinforcement platform has a curved surface abutting against the bottom end of the cement drainage pipe.
本实用新型的优点是:梯形加固台可使排水管道在已被挖动过的土壤中保持水平固定,使排水管道之间容易紧密连接。 The utility model has the advantages that: the trapezoidal reinforcing platform can keep the drainage pipes horizontally fixed in the excavated soil, so that the drainage pipes can be easily connected closely.
